Global Headlines Vietnam aims to send 125,000 labourers abroad this year

Vietnam aims to send 125,000 labourers abroad to work under contracts in 2024, focusing on key traditional markets such as Japan, China's Taiwan and South Korea, Vietnam News Agency reported Tuesday, citing the Ministry of Labor, Invalids and Social Affairs.
The country will send about 48,000 workers to Taiwan, 63,000 labourers to Japan and 8,500 to South Korea this year, according to the ministry.
In 2023, the number of Vietnamese labourers sent to work abroad under contract reached its peak with 155,000 people.
There are currently about 650,000 Vietnamese guest workers in 40 countries and regions in the world.
